Sanjay Dutt is set to revisit one of his most iconic roles, announcing a sequel titled Khalnayak Returns, based on the 1993 cult hit Khal Nayak.
At a recent event, the actor confirmed that he will once again play Ballu Balram, the rebellious character that made a huge impact when the original film released over 30 years ago.
Dutt shared a personal connection to the sequel’s idea, saying it came to him while he was in jail during his legal troubles in the 1990s. He recalled discussing the concept with fellow inmates, many of whom encouraged him to turn it into a film and even shared story ideas.
Over the years, the idea gradually developed into a full project, eventually taking shape with filmmaker Subhash Ghai, who directed the original movie, also involved in the rights and production discussions.
A teaser released along with the announcement gives a glimpse of Ballu’s return, hinting at a darker and more intense version of the character. While details about the storyline are still under wraps, the film is expected to continue the legacy of the original while giving it a modern twist.
The 1993 Khal Nayak was a major success and is still remembered for its strong performances, music, and Dutt’s portrayal of an anti-hero caught between crime and redemption.
